When shipping from Rotterdam to Nashville, anticipate significant delays due to North European winter storms (November-March); build in additional buffer days and flexible delivery windows. During the Christmas retail peak (October-December), secure vessel space well in advance to avoid congestion. Additionally, coordinate closely with carriers for real-time updates on weather disruptions and schedule adjustments, particularly during the Atlantic hurricane season (June-November). Lastly, consider reduced labor availability during the European summer holiday peak (July-August) to ensure timely deliveries.

For moisture-sensitive Toys, Use a multi-layer approach: inner Poly bag or shrink wrap around the product or retail box, then a Sturdy corrugated carton with cushioning. Add moisture absorbers for long-distance or ocean shipments of Sports equipment.
For most Toys and sporting goods, a Standard dry container Is sufficient, but shippers should Verify door seals and Add drying agents. For High-value board games with sensitive cardboard or printed materials, look at Ventilated containers on routes with large temperature swings.
To reduce stacking damage for Medium-weight Toys and games, Use stronger boxes, Limit pallet height, and Place edge protectors. Mark pallets of games with “Do Not Double Stack” where appropriate, and confirm heavier sports equipment are not loaded on top of lighter leisure products.
Yes, many countries Apply Safety and labeling rules for Toys and games. Shippers should Verify that all Toys meet destination standards (such as ASTM/EN standards) and that Documentation is available if customs requests it. Some sports equipment, such as items with Batteries, may also fall under restricted articles rules and require declared classification.
Because Toys and games often have High retail value and are vulnerable to Moisture damage, taking out cargo insurance Is strongly recommended. Insure your games at Full replacement value and verify that the policy Covers humidity damage, especially for ocean or long-term storage moves.
When shipping Toys & Sporting Goods via ocean freight, it is important to ensure that products are packaged securely to withstand the rigors of ocean transport. Items should be protected from moisture and impacts, especially since toys and sporting goods can vary in size and fragility. Additionally, compliance with safety regulations and standards applicable in the United States must be verified prior to shipping.
The required documentation for shipping Toys & Sporting Goods includes a commercial invoice, packing list, and any necessary certificates that prove compliance with U.S. safety standards. Additionally, a bill of lading and customs declaration must be prepared to facilitate clearance at both the port of Rotterdam and upon arrival in Nashville.
